Exploring Bangkok’s Iconic Landmarks: Temples and Palaces

Bangkok, often referred to as the “City of Angels,” is a vibrant metropolis where modernity and tradition coexist harmoniously. For the first section of your five-day itinerary, delve into the city’s rich cultural and historical tapestry by visiting its most revered temples and palaces. The magnificent Grand Palace tops the list. This former royal residence stands as an architectural marvel and a symbol of Thailand’s monarchy. The complex also houses the renowned Wat Phra Kaew, or Temple of the Emerald Buddha, regarded as the most sacred Buddhist temple in Thailand.

After exploring the intricate beauty of the Grand Palace, head to Wat Pho, the Temple of the Reclining Buddha. It is famed for its enormous golden Buddha statue, which is a sight to behold. This temple complex is also a hub for traditional Thai massage and foot reflexology training.

Another must-visit is Wat Arun, or the Temple of Dawn, located on the Thonburi side of the Chao Phraya River. The temple is renowned for its distinctive prang (spire), which offers breathtaking views of the river and cityscape. For an enhanced experience, consider booking a combined tour of the Grand Palace, Wat Pho, and Wat Arun to fully appreciate these iconic landmarks.

As the day winds down, opt for a Chao Phraya River Cruise to witness Bangkok’s illuminated attractions from a different perspective. This captivating journey offers a stunning view as landmarks like the Grand Palace and Wat Arun are bathed in evening lights. Complete the day with a visit to Asiatique The Riverfront, where you can enjoy riverside dining and browsing eclectic shops. This bustling night market is perfect for grabbing local souvenirs and enjoying the vibrant nightlife. With this adventure-packed itinerary, you’ll experience the spiritual side and historical grandeur of Bangkok.

Temple Exploration Tips

  • Wear respectful attire: Cover shoulders and knees.
  • Visit early to avoid crowds and heat.
  • Guided tours offer insightful historic context.
  • Photography is allowed, but avoid flash in temple areas.

Immerse Yourself in Bangkok’s Market Culture

Your second day in Bangkok offers an exciting dive into the city’s bustling market culture. Begin with a tour to the Damnoen Saduak Floating Market, located just outside the city. This unique market gives a glimpse into traditional Thai trading, where vendors sell goods directly from their boats. Look forward to trying local delicacies such as freshly made noodles, sticky mango rice, and coconut ice cream as you float on the quaint canals.

Next, make a stop at the Maeklong Railway Market, where your heart will race as vendors quickly retract their stalls to make way for incoming trains—a truly exhilarating scene!

After returning to Bangkok, it is time to indulge in a Thai culinary experience at a local restaurant. Savor traditional dishes like Pad Thai and Tom Yum Goong (spicy shrimp soup). If you’re feeling adventurous, explore Bangkok’s street food offerings for even more delectable surprises.

The afternoon is perfect for a shopping spree at Bangkok’s renowned malls. Start at Siam Paragon, known for its luxury brands and Sea Life Bangkok. For a more wallet-friendly selection, visit the iconic MBK Center, famous for electronics and fashion deals. Others like Siam Discovery, which boasts modern architecture, and Terminal 21, with its airport-themed concept, make for unique shopping experiences.

Family-Friendly Adventures and Sky-High Views

Start day three with a visit to Safari World, one of Bangkok’s top attractions for families. Offering both a Safari Park and a Marine Park, it provides thrilling experiences of observing animals like tigers, giraffes, and lions in an open-air environment. The Marine Park also features entertaining shows such as dolphin and orangutan performances, which are a delight for children and adults alike.

After a morning immersed in nature and wildlife, proceed to one of Bangkok’s architectural marvels—the King Power Mahanakhon Tower. Situated on the 78th floor, the Mahanakhon Skywalk presents breathtaking 360-degree views of Bangkok. The glass floor offers a thrilling experience as the city unfolds beneath your feet. Don’t miss the sunset views which transform the city with hues of orange and pink.

For a unique twist, include Space & Time Cube+ in your itinerary, where digital art meets technology to create an interactive experience.

As evening sets, explore the iconic Khao San Road. Known as the backpacker’s mecca, this famous street comes alive with its eclectic mix of bars, street food, and shops. Dive into delicious local delicacies like mango sticky rice and Pad Thai while enjoying the vibrant atmosphere that encapsulates Bangkok’s night culture.

Day Trip to Pattaya: Beaches, Culture, and Entertainment

The fourth day of your Bangkok adventure offers a chance to explore nearby Pattaya, a city renowned for its beaches and vibrant attractions. Start your excursion by visiting the Sanctuary of Truth, an awe-inspiring wooden temple that combines astounding craftsmanship with spiritual significance.

Continue to the famous Tiger Park Pattaya, where you can marvel at majestic big cats and capture memorable photographs. Adventure seekers can book tandem skydiving experiences for a thrilling perspective of Pattaya.

As the day unfolds, a visit to the Pattaya Floating Market offers a vibrant scene of local crafts, Thai silk, and tantalizing street food. Take a leisurely boat ride for a truly immersive marketplace experience.

Final Day: Relaxation and Unforgettable Performances

On the last day of your itinerary, embark on a serene journey to Koh Larn Island with a morning boat ride. Known for its postcard-worthy beaches, clear waters, and vibrant marine life, Koh Larn offers a peaceful escape from the bustling city. Relax on the sandy shores or partake in exciting water activities like snorkeling and parasailing.

Include a visit to Ripley’s Believe It or Not Pattaya for an afternoon of curiosity and wonder, with its wide array of bizarre artifacts and interactive exhibits. As evening descends, immerse yourself in the vibrant performances of the Alcazar Cabaret Show. This renowned performance features beautifully costumed transgender dancers delivering stunning choreographic and musical acts.

How should I dress when visiting Bangkok’s temples?

When visiting temples in Bangkok, wear clothing that covers your shoulders and knees. Inappropriate attire may lead to denial of entry.

What is unique about the Maeklong Railway Market?

The Maeklong Railway Market is unique because vendors must swiftly retract their stalls to make way for passing trains, creating an exhilarating experience for visitors.

Can I include Pattaya in my Bangkok trip?

Yes, including Pattaya in your Bangkok trip is feasible. With its beaches and attractions like the Sanctuary of Truth, it offers a diverse experience.
